2024年6月26日 · Warm Light vs. Cool Light: What is the Difference? The key difference between warm and cool light is their color temperature and appearance. Warm light has a color temperature below 3000 Kelvin (K) and contains reddish and yellow tones, while cool light has a color temperature above 4000 Kelvin (K) and has a bluish-white appearance.
